Unveiling the Mystery: What Exactly IS a Bread Enhancer?

So, what exactly are these mysterious bread enhancers? Simply put, they are a variety of ingredients added to bread dough to achieve specific results. Think of them as your secret weapon for baking success! They can be anything from enzymes and emulsifiers to dough conditioners and gluten developers. The goal? To improve the bread's volume, texture, crumb structure, flavor, and even its ability to stay fresh longer. It's like giving your bread a super boost! The use of bread enhancers has become increasingly popular over the years, and for good reason. They allow bakers, both professional and home cooks, to achieve consistent and desirable results every single time. Moreover, they are especially crucial when dealing with varying environmental conditions, the quality of ingredients, and the demands of large-scale production.

Bread enhancers are not a single ingredient but rather a collective term for a range of components. These can include: enzymes, which break down complex starches into simpler sugars, providing food for the yeast and enhancing flavor; emulsifiers, like lecithin or DATEM, which help to distribute fat and water evenly, leading to a softer crumb and improved texture; dough conditioners, which strengthen the gluten network and improve dough handling; and oxidizing agents, which help to strengthen the dough and improve its structure. The specific types and combinations of enhancers used will vary depending on the type of bread being made, the desired characteristics, and the baking process. Some bakers might opt for a simple enhancer, while others utilize a complex blend of several ingredients to achieve perfection. Why Use Bread Enhancers? The Amazing Benefits

Alright, now that we know what they are, let's talk about why you'd actually want to use bread enhancers. The benefits are numerous, and they can significantly impact the quality of your bread. It's all about making your bread the best it can be, right? Using these enhancers can bring a lot of benefits to the bread-making process. The most important benefits include improving the volume, texture, and shelf life of your bread.

Firstly, bread enhancers enhance volume and texture: They can increase the loaf's volume, resulting in a lighter, airier texture. This is because they help the dough trap more gas during fermentation, leading to a fluffier final product. Emulsifiers, for instance, create a finer crumb structure. It basically means the bread will have more small air pockets, making it feel less dense and more pleasant to eat. Additionally, certain enhancers can improve dough extensibility, making it easier to shape and work with. This is really useful if you're making complex shapes or working with challenging doughs.

Secondly, bread enhancers improve shelf life: One of the biggest challenges with homemade bread is keeping it fresh. Bread enhancers can help extend the shelf life of your bread, meaning it will stay softer and more palatable for longer. They do this by slowing down the staling process, which is the process where the bread loses moisture and becomes hard. This is particularly helpful if you bake in advance or want to store your bread for a few days. Bread enhancers also help prevent mold growth and maintain the bread's flavor and texture over time, so you can enjoy fresh-tasting bread for longer. This is a game-changer for anyone who loves to have fresh bread on hand, but doesn't want to bake every day. Who wouldn't want bread that stays soft and delicious for longer?

Thirdly, bread enhancers enhance flavor and appearance: Some bread enhancers can subtly enhance the flavor profile of the bread. For example, enzymes can break down starches, creating more sugars, which, in turn, caramelize during baking, resulting in a more complex, richer flavor. Bread enhancers can also improve the crust's color and texture. For example, certain enhancers contribute to a more golden-brown crust, making your bread look as good as it tastes. Types of Bread Enhancers: A Deep Dive

Okay, so we've established that bread enhancers are awesome. But let's get into the nitty-gritty and explore the different types you might encounter. Understanding these will help you choose the right ones for your specific needs. Each type has its unique role in improving the bread-making process.

Enzymes

Enzymes are biological catalysts that speed up chemical reactions in the dough. There are several types of enzymes used in bread making, each with a specific function. Amylases, for example, break down starch into sugars, which the yeast then feeds on, producing carbon dioxide and creating a fluffy texture. Proteases, on the other hand, break down proteins, which helps to relax the gluten, making the dough more extensible and easier to work with. There are also lipases, which break down fats to improve dough texture. Enzymes are often derived from grains, such as wheat or barley, or produced through fermentation. They are a natural and effective way to enhance the flavor, texture, and overall quality of your bread. They are often a key ingredient in many bread enhancer blends, as they contribute significantly to the desired characteristics of the bread.

Emulsifiers

Emulsifiers are ingredients that help mix oil and water, which don't naturally blend. They improve the texture and volume of bread by evenly distributing the fats and liquids throughout the dough. Common emulsifiers include lecithin, which is often derived from soybeans, and DATEM (Diacetyl Tartaric Acid Esters of Monoglycerides). These ingredients help create a finer crumb structure, resulting in a softer and more pleasant mouthfeel. Emulsifiers also contribute to the bread's shelf life, helping to keep it moist and preventing it from drying out too quickly. They are essential for creating a uniform texture and are particularly useful in recipes that contain fats. They can also improve dough's extensibility and reduce stickiness. Emulsifiers really are a key ingredient for achieving that perfect, soft texture.

Dough Conditioners

Dough conditioners are designed to strengthen the gluten network in the dough. Stronger gluten means a better ability to trap gas, resulting in a lighter and more voluminous loaf. Common dough conditioners include ascorbic acid (vitamin C), which acts as an oxidizing agent, and vital wheat gluten, which is added to increase the protein content of the flour. Dough conditioners improve the dough's elasticity and resilience, making it easier to handle and shape. They also help to create a more consistent crumb structure, reducing the chances of large holes in your bread. These are crucial if you're dealing with weak flour or trying to achieve a specific bread structure. They can help make a dough more tolerant of variations in ingredients and environmental conditions. Ultimately, they play a huge role in creating bread that is visually appealing and structurally sound.

Oxidizing Agents

Oxidizing agents strengthen the gluten network in the dough. By oxidizing the gluten proteins, they promote the formation of disulfide bonds, which improve the dough's strength and elasticity. This leads to a better oven spring, meaning the bread will rise more in the oven, creating a lighter and more open crumb. Common oxidizing agents include ascorbic acid (vitamin C) and potassium bromate (though potassium bromate's use is highly regulated). These agents can also improve the dough's tolerance to over-mixing and proofing, making the baking process more reliable. In addition, oxidizing agents can improve the bread's texture and overall appearance. These are a great ingredient for creating a better structure and a more aesthetically pleasing loaf of bread.

How to Use Bread Enhancers: Tips and Tricks

Alright, you're ready to start using bread enhancers! But before you go wild, here are a few tips and tricks to make sure you get the best results. It's like any good recipe; following some guidelines will set you up for success. Pay attention to how to best utilize these enhancers.

  • Start Small: When you're trying out a new enhancer, it's always best to start with a small amount and gradually increase it until you achieve the desired effect. Different flours and recipes will respond differently, so experimentation is key. Overuse can sometimes lead to undesirable results, like a rubbery texture. Start by adding a small percentage of the enhancer to your flour weight, and then adjust it based on your results. Keep detailed notes about your recipes and any changes you make, so you can replicate your successes. You'll soon find the sweet spot for your particular baking style.
  • Read the Label: Pay close attention to the instructions on the bread enhancer package. Different enhancers will have different usage rates and recommended methods. Always follow the manufacturer's guidelines to avoid any issues. Understanding the recommended usage rates and methods is essential to ensure that the enhancer works as intended, and that you get the best possible outcome. Also, it’s a good idea to check the expiration date to ensure that the enhancer is still active. The label will also provide important information regarding ingredient composition and any potential allergens.
  • Consider Your Flour: The type of flour you use will influence the effectiveness of your bread enhancer. High-protein flours (like bread flour) often require different enhancers or different amounts than all-purpose flour. Using a lower-protein flour might require a stronger enhancer. Also, consider the specific characteristics of your flour. If your flour tends to produce a dense dough, you may want to use enhancers that promote volume and airiness. If your flour is weak, focus on conditioners to strengthen the gluten network. Experimentation and paying attention to your flour are key to success.
  • Proper Mixing: Make sure the enhancer is evenly distributed throughout the dough. Add it during the initial mixing stages to ensure that it has time to work its magic. Make sure to mix the dough thoroughly. This ensures the ingredients blend evenly and that the enhancer is distributed throughout the dough. For example, if you are using an emulsifier, proper mixing helps to distribute fats and liquids, which leads to a more uniform texture. Using the correct mixing technique will greatly improve the consistency and quality of your baked goods. Uneven mixing can lead to inconsistent results.
